Each day during Black History Month, the Black Student Union will share information about an individual who has made significant contributions to American history and culture.
February 3 Ruby Bridges, born September 8, 1954, is a lifelong civil rights activist. At just six years old, she integrated an all white elementary school in New Orleans, Louisiana. Ruby had to walk into school escorted by four federal marshals as crowds yelled terrible things at her. She says of her walk into school, “I wanted to use my experience to teach kids that racism has no place in hearts and minds.” She is now chair of the Ruby Bridges Foundation, which she formed in 1999 to promote "the values of tolerance, respect, and appreciation of all differences".
